CHILDREN’S MINISTRY FALL ACTIVITY

Here’s a fun Fall activity to do in your Children’s Ministry or Children’s Church.
Opening Fun
Hand each child a blank sheet of paper and crayons/markers. Have them draw a big leaf (or provide leaf templates).
Ask: What’s your favorite thing about fall? (pumpkin pie, football, crunchy leaves, sweaters, etc.)
Let a few share.
Activity – “Falling Leaves Toss”
Write different things kids might worry about (school, friends, family, tests, etc.) on paper leaves (you can make them ahead of time or let kids brainstorm and write them).
Put a big basket or box in the center labeled “God’s Hands.” Kids take turns tossing their “worry leaves” into the basket, saying aloud: “God, I give you [whatever is written on the leaf].”
Bible Lesson Tie-In
Read Ecclesiastes 3:1: “There is a time for everything, and a season for every activity under the heavens.”
Say: Just like seasons change, summer to fall, life has different seasons too. Some are fun and exciting, some are hard. But in every season, God is with us. Just like the leaves fall, we can let go of our worries and trust God to take care of us.
Ask: What’s something you need to “let fall” into God’s hands today?
Kids can write or draw one last “leaf” to keep and take home as a reminder.
Close in prayer.
(End Lesson.)
